The fusion has 5"x7" stock speaker locations. Trying to fit any of the standard configs may lead to a lot of trouble and will definitely need modding and tinkering with the interior trim.

Not really. There are 5x7 component and coaxial options from Hertz, JBL and Blaupunkt that will fit without any mods.
